Strongsville Mustangs 2022 Baseball Preview

Strongsville Mustangs

Head Coach: Doug Cicerchi
Years Head Coach (current school): 9
Record (current school): 118-77
Years Head Coach (overall): 9
Record (overall): 118-77

Record last season: 7-5; 17-11
League Affiliation: Greater Cleveland Conference
Last year's playoff results:
Sectional Semifinal: Bye
Sectional Final: Defeated Wooster 6-2
District Semifinal: Defeated St. Edward 11-0 (6 inn.)
District Final: Lost to Brunswick 6-1

Top players returning:
Sr. SS Gus Gregory (.348/.570/.725, 4 2B, 5 3B, 4 HR, 14 RBI, 33 R, 24 BB, 13 HBP, 13 SB; 1st Team GCC All-Conference; 1st team NEOBCA All-District; Honorable Mention OHSBCA All-State; Wright St. University Commit)

Sr. 3B Anthony Gentile (.382/.584/.574, 7 2B, 2 HR, 24 RBI, 21 R, 19 BB, 14 HBP, 9 SB; 1st Team GCC All-Conference; 2nd Team NEOBCA All-District; University of Dayton Football Commit)

Sr. C Mitchel Szymczak (.300/.442/.425, 8 2B, 1 3B, 20 RBI, 23 R, 19 BB, 13 SB; 1st Team GCC All-Conference; Honorable Mention NEOBCA All-District; Lake Erie College Commit)

Sr. P/OF Maddux Beard (7 GS, 35.2 IP, 2-1, 2.75 ERA, 27 H, 10 BB, 33 K (GCC Honorable Mention)

19 total seniors: Gregory, Gentile, Szymczak, Beard, OF/RHP Aidan Cunningham, RHP Michael DiSanza, RHP Anthony Favazza, RHP Evan Hatfield, C Justin Haumesser, 1B/OF Zak Kakos, OF John Kasler, 1B/3B Nathan Kowalski, RHP Justin Malloy (Walsh University commit), 3B Jake Morad (Lake Erie College Commit), OF/RHP Alex Morales, RHP Alex Seghy, LHP Liam Shea, OF/2B/3B/RHP Ethan Stross, RHP/OF Connor Zitnar

Final Comments:
We might be the oldest team in the state but that's because we have a senior group that is very talented and love to play together. I think it's a special group and while we have talked about how that doesn't guarantee anything, we just want to enjoy the journey and truly have fun at each practice and game. When this group plays loose, they play their best. We also have some impact younger guys that should fulfill key roles throughout the season. We should have a very good team offense with a nice mix of plate discipline, the ability to drive the baseball consistently, team speed, smart baserunning, and depth throughout our lineup/several guys off the bench in any given game. Our pitching has made a leap in early bullpens; we'll see how that translates to games. If we can throw enough strikes with the stuff our guys have shown, we'll have a chance to beat anybody we play.
